计划

  • 将Apache和Nginx单独变成文档

分类

  • Windows
    • ISS,C#
  • Linux
    • LAMP(狭义):Linux,Apache,MySQL,PHP
    • LNMP(狭义):Linux,Nginx,MySQL,PHP
    • Apache + Nginx

ISS(待完成)

Apache

Nginx

网站搭建

Windows + ISS(待完成)

  • 18机器网站

Linux + Apache(待完成)

Linux + Nginx

Linux + Apache + Nginx

  • 55机器做法:Apache2 + Nginx
1
有的会用apache去跑php,然后用nginx做反向代理,比如apache运行在8080端口,nginx在80端口,访问php文件时,反向代理到apache,静态页通过nginx处理。nginx支持高并发,apache对php的运行比较稳定
  • 两者默认都监听80端口,需要配置其中一个监听其他端口
  • 然后在Nginx中使用端口转发到Apache服务

域名绑定

参考

  1. How To Find Out Apache Version Using Command
  2. How To Find Out Nginx Version using command line
  3. Apache HTTP 服务器 2.4 文档
  4. Is there any difference between apache2 and httpd?
  5. Difference between Apache and Apache 2
  6. Upgrading to 2.0 from 1.3
  7. iis配置端口号详细步骤
  8. 可以同时装apache和nginx么
  9. 关于Nginx与Apache共存的解决方法